Junior Space Security Architect

Telespazio UK, part of a dynamic company with over 3500 talented individuals working in the fields of Space Systems, operations, and Geo-Information. As part of the Leonardo Group, one of the UK's largest Defence, Aerospace, and Security companies.

Are you passionate about cybersecurity and the space domain? Telespazio offers an exciting entry-level opportunity to join our growing space security team. You will support senior architects on cutting-edge projects for government and commercial clients, gaining hands-on experience in cybersecurity design and architecture.

Key Skills & Competencies
  1. Security Awareness
    • Understanding of security controls and technologies
    • Interest in cybersecurity design and architecture
  2. Technical Mindset
    • Ability to quickly learn new technologies, standards, and frameworks
    • Basic understanding of cryptographic functions and tools
    • Familiarity with core network security tools and cloud computing (any provider)
  3. Documentation & Communication
    • Strong MS Office and documentation skills
    • Experience writing technical requirements
  4. Education & Training
    • Technical or engineering degree preferred
    • Certifications (e.g., CISSP, CISM, TOGAF, MODAF, SABSA) are a plus but not essential. Training will be provided.
